Skip to Content
Shop
Aide
0
418 209-5229
English (US)
English (US)
Français (CA)
Sign in
Contact Us
0
Shop
Aide
418 209-5229
English (US)
English (US)
Français (CA)
Sign in
Contact Us
Your Email
Reset Password
Back to Login